If I remember correctly, weapons stopped breaking after you killed that guy in the Nashkel mines and "solved" the iron crisis, right?
No, you could buy more expensive non-breakable weapons from one smith afterwards. But you wouldn't because magic weapons were unbreakable and by then you probably had enough for your party by then.
Normal weapons made of metal still have a chance to break on critical failure, if you fail the following death save
Then there's the iron crisis chance to break, which is a low % on every hit, on top of that, which disappears after you bring the samples to the blacksmith

Originally she wasn't part of the plot at all, and her voiceover lines were recorded for a female extra. She was only added when playtesters complained that the early chapters of the game were too difficult to complete if the PC didn't recruit unstable nutjob Montaron into the party (this is the reason she never interacts with other NPCs, incidentally — there was no time to record additional dialog).
Imoen was also originally supposed to die in Spellhold. The developers changed their minds upon seeing fan poll results, leading to the aforementioned RetCon.
